White Belt - 10th Kup

White Belt Terminology

Taekwondo originated in....Korea

Training Suit....Dobok

Instructor....Sabumnim

White means....innocence

Training Hall....Dojang

Sitting Stance....Annun Sogi

Front Kick....Ap Chagi

Punch....Jirugi

Weight Distribution-Sitting Stance....50/50

Founder of Taekwondo....General Choi Hong Hi

White Belt Practical

Sitting Stance 10 punches

4 Directional Front Kick

4 Directional Punch

4 Directional Block

One Step Number 1

Release from single wrist grab

Power test - Front Kick - shield

White

Means innocence, the wearer has little or no knowledge of Taekwondo.

10 Press Ups

Under 12 years - on knee's and flat of hand

Over 12 years - on feet and flat of hand

Over 18's - on feet and knuckles

Tenets of Taekwondo

Courtesy - Integrity - Perserverance - Self Control - Indomitable Spirit

Students Oath

I shall respect the Instructor and Seniors

I shall observe the Tenets of Taekwondo

I shall never misuse Taekwondo

I shall be a champion of freedom and justice

I shall strive to build a more peaceful World
